How much do data entry operator j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 9, 2026, the average hourly pay for data entry operator in Philadelphia, PA is $20.98,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.53 and $21.59 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a data entry operator do?

A Data Entry Operator is responsible for inputting, updating, and maintaining information in computer systems and databases. They ensure that the data is accurate, complete, and entered in a timely manner. Typical duties include typing information from physical documents or digital files, verifying data for errors, and sometimes performing basic data analysis. Data Entry Operators play a crucial role in helping organizations keep their records organized and accessible.

What are some common challenges data entry operators face, and how can they overcome them?

Data Entry Operators often encounter challenges such as repetitive tasks, tight deadlines, and maintaining high accuracy under pressure. To overcome these, it's important to develop strong organizational habits, take regular breaks to avoid fatigue, and utilize keyboard shortcuts to boost efficiency. Staying detail-oriented and double-checking work can help minimize errors, while open communication with supervisors ensures priorities are clear and support is available when needed.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a data entry operator,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Data Entry Operator, you need fast and accurate typing skills, attention to detail, and a basic educational background such as a high school diploma. Familiarity with spreadsheet software (like Microsoft Excel), data management systems, and sometimes specialized database tools is typically required. Strong organizational skills, reliability, and the ability to work independently help someone excel in this role. These skills ensure data integrity, minimize errors, and support efficient workflow within organizations that rely on accurate record-keeping.

Is data entry a hard job to get?

Data entry is generally an accessible job that often requires basic computer skills, attention to detail, and familiarity with spreadsheet or database software. While some positions may prefer prior experience or certifications, many entry-level roles are available and do not require extensive qualifications.
